Although credited to edgar rice burroughs, it was written by his son, john coleman burroughs and was later expanded and republished in amazing stories as john carter and the giant of mars, the name it goes under in the collection. John carter and the giant of mars first appeared in the january 1941 issue of amazing stories, and was written by burroughs and his youngest son john coleman burroughs. The first story was originally published in 1940 by whitman as a better little book entitled john carter of mars. It is based on the barsoom series of novels by edgar rice burroughs.
